Job Description - Incident Controller

Incident Controller 

ScottishPower HQ

Salary from  £34,040 - £42,550 per annum + Shift allowance of around £9k per annum

Permanent

Closing date: 8th July 2026

Help us create a better future, quicker 

As an Incident Controller, you’ll be responsible for the real-time coordination and management of network incidents across the franchise area, ensuring accurate outage management, resource allocation, customer communications, and regulatory reporting. The role maintains and updates PowerOn and associated systems, supports informed decision-making by providing timely customer and network information to field teams, manages vulnerable customer processes, handles overnight customer enquiries, and promotes the effective use of PowerOn Mobile to support efficient network restoration and a high standard of customer service.

What you’ll be doing 

  • Correctly process PowerOn incidents, ensuring correct staff and contract resources are prioritised and dispatched to achieve supply restorations.
  • Monitor critical information and coordinate with other members of the incident management team to ensure incidents are prioritised accordingly.
  • Decide on the best allocation of jobs to optimise the utilisation of field resources and escalate staff surpluses/deficiencies to achieve performance requirements in the most cost-effective manner. Allocation through PowerOn Mobile to be maximised.
  • Liaise with field staff to continually monitor incident/fault progress for GS and OS compliance and report exceptions.
  • Work as a team with other Incident Controllers to seek to share workload and resources across zones.
  • Ensure all systems are updated to required standards and complete reporting associated with operations processes.
  • Ensure all vulnerable customer(s) are supported and managed positively throughout and this information is updated on the incident log. Ensure that all requests and information are followed through and recorded.
  • Assist field staff with information held in central systems to reduce the time taken to identify and locate supply problems.
  • Use of UMV, VPB, Netview
  • Recording the use and location of test equipment.
  • Produce mandatory reports for Electricity Supply Regulation 31 reports.
  • Liaise with operational staff to make ad-hoc updates to VPB.
  • Liaise with DCC, Incident Management, Field Staff and customers to ensure customer information is of adequate standard and provided in a timely fashion.
  • Be actively involved in promoting Customer Service, and assisting when necessary to implement Customer Contact Plans and escalation process
  • Assist in training of new appointees and support staff.
  • Monitor work outstanding to ensure jobs are progressed.
  • Pass defined work to other departments e.g. shrouding requests, hazard report forms, voltage checks, etc.
  • Be active in the improvement/development and introduction of new processes, procedures, initiatives and new technology
  • NRSWA as required
  • Liaise with Customer contact staff and Production Team to provide information when required.
  • Manage customer phone calls in a professional manner, providing correct safety advice

 Why SP Energy Networks 

SP Energy Networks is part of the Iberdrola Group, one of the world’s largest integrated utility companies and a world leader in wind energy. We keep electricity flowing to homes and businesses through Central and Southern Scotland, North Wales and in the North West of England. We operate over 4000km of cables and lines that make-up the transmission network – connecting infrastructure like wind farms into the electricity system. It’s a role that puts us right at the heart of Scotland’s ambition to be Net Zero by 2044. And we’re taking it very seriously. We’re investing >£5.5 billion into our transmission network, directly supporting the rapid growth needed in renewable energy.
